KATY, TEXAS —American Landmark, a Tampa-based multifamily owner-operator, has acquired Elan 99 West, a 360-unit multifamily community in Katy, a western suburb of Houston that will be rebranded as Elite 99 West. Built in 2016, the property features one-, two- and three-bedroom units with quartz countertops, washes and dryers, private patios and yards, walk-in closets and wood flooring. Community amenities include a pool with lounge seating, lake with jogging path, fitness center, outdoor kitchen and lounge and a clubhouse. Mitch Sinberg, Matthew Robbins, Robert Falese and Matthew Cullison of Berkadia arranged acquisition financing on behalf of American Landmark, which will implement a $1.3 million capital improvements program. Following this transaction, American Landmark now owns and manages about 28,000 apartments throughout the Southeast and Texas.

NEW JERSEY — NorthMarq has secured a $69 million loan for the refinancing of four affordable housing properties all in Hudson County, a western suburb of New York City. The properties include Church Square South, an 81-unit property in Hoboken; Eastview Apartments, a 79-unit property also in Hoboken; New Floral Gardens, a 91-unit property in North Bergen; and Parkview East, a 71-unit property in Weehawken. Gary Cohen of NorthMarq secured the refinancing through two New Jersey-based banks. The borrower was not disclosed.
DALLAS — CBRE has negotiated the sale of a 14-property, 431,902-square-foot retail portfolio located throughout Texas. The seller was Dallas-based Rainier Cos., which disposed of the assets as part of the sale of a 677,979-square-foot portfolio of 27 retail properties in seven states. The larger portfolio was 92 percent leased at the time of sale. The buyer and sales price were not disclosed. Michael Austry and Jared Aubrey of CBRE handled the transaction.
SAN ANTONIO — Berkadia has arranged the sale of Villas de Santa Fe, a 208-unit multifamily asset located near San Antonio Medical Center on the city’s northwest side. Built in 1982, the property features one- and two-bedroom units with tile floorings, window coverings, pantries, solar screens and washer and dryer connections. Community amenities include a clubhouse, swimming pool, fitness center, picnic area and a sports court. Mike Miller, Will Caruth, Chris Ross and Cody Courtney of Berkadia handled the transaction on behalf of the seller, San Diego-based Comunidad Realty Partners. The buyer was not disclosed.
REVERE, MASS. — CBRE has arranged a $20.5 million construction loan for a multifamily property in Revere, a northern suburb of Boston. Located at 90 Ocean Ave., the six-story property will offer 75 apartment units, including studio, one- and two-bedroom floor plans. The building will also include a fitness center and rooftop lounge. John Kelly of CBRE arranged the financing on behalf of the borrower, Helge Capital Inc.
NEW HAVEN, CT. — Pearce Real Estate has brokered the $5 million sale of three adjacent multifamily and office properties in New Haven. The properties comprise the Farrel Mansion at 490 Propspect St.; Doane Hall at 492 Prospect St.; Great Hall at 411 Mansfield St. Combined, the properties offer 28,659 square feet that the buyer, Albertus Magnus College, plans to use for additional dorm space. Jamie Cuzzocreo of Pearce represented Albertus Magnus in the transaction. Frank D’Ostilio of Real Living represented the seller, Overseas Ministries.
CARLSTADT, N.J. — Josmo Shoes has signed a 26,000-square-foor industrial lease in Carlstadt, a northwestern suburb of New York City. The building at 75 Triangle Blvd. features three loading docks and 18-foot ceiling heights. Josmo will use the property as a secondary warehouse and distribution center to support its New York headquarters. Shawn Roth, David Cantor and Greg Sholom of Team Resources Inc. represented Josmo in the lease negotiations.
NEW YORK CITY — Inked Magazine, a tattoo lifestyle publication and a division of Quadra Media, has signed an 8,500-square-foot retail lease at 150 West 22nd St. in Manhattan. The new location will house a tattoo studio, art gallery, photography studio and retail store offering apparel, branded merchandise and art. The store will be Inked Magazine’s first retail property. Eli Someck of and Justin Myers of Redwood Property Group represented Inked Magazine in the lease negotiations. Someck also represented the landlord, M. Rapaport Co.
EL PASO, TEXAS — Locally based shopping center developer River Oaks Properties has broken ground on Eastlake Marketplace, a 252,000-square-foot retail power center that will be located at the corner of Interstate 10 and Eastlake Boulevard in El Paso. The opening is scheduled for late 2020.
HOUSTON — Hillcroft Partners has purchased Stonecreek Plaza, a 63,890-square-foot mixed-use property in Houston that includes warehouse, office and retail space. Jared Pinto of Newcor Commercial Real Estate represented the seller, a private investor, in the transaction. The buyer was self-represented.
